About
Eric Bishop, Ed.D., brings more than 20 years of experience in higher education leadership, teaching, and community engagement to Riverside City College. He most recently served as interim vice chancellor of the Riverside Community College District, following leadership roles at the University of La Verne, Ohlone College, and Chaffey College. A dedicated advocate for access, equity, and student success, Bishop has also taught at the graduate level and served as a trustee for Bethany Theological Seminary. He holds an Ed.D. in organizational leadership, along with master’s and bachelor’s degrees from the University of La Verne.
